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2878445 616274 2938918 896155
0815147 6776 11
0815147 6776 11
18498320 28711757222 73380411 223 42
All about undefined
Interested in learning more?
0815147 6776 11
18498320 28711757222 73380411 223 42
See more
9074225 61 2914092
5580003 510338608 3007344071
See more
886384596 579506 135838
73868 199 210545
See more